Semipalmated Plover


A very heavily cropped image of a Semipalmated Plover, a first for me! We saw a group of six of these birds today, on drive south east of the city, to the Wyndham/Carseland, Langdon Reservoir and Weed Lake area. These birds are not often seen - they are migrating quickly through the area at the moment - so we were lucky to see them. They are similar to, but smaller than, the more common Killdeer. They were amazingly well camouflaged amongst the rocks.
